5 Traits To Look for in a CNC Shop Supervisor

Posted on Jun 17, 2016 12:00:00 AM

Not everyone is cut out to be a CNC machine shop supervisor. You may have learned this the hard way by hiring or promoting someone into a supervisory role only to discover that they simply couldn’t handle the job. Fact is, the talents and skills that make a good machine operator or programmer may not be enough to enable a person to successfully supervise others. Being a supervisor requires the ability to juggle a number of responsibilities while leading, not just managing others.

So whether you plan to promote from within or hire outside, here are 5 key questions to ask yourself when filling a supervisory position:

  1. How well does the candidate know the jobs he or she will supervise? Do they understand your workflow? Are they familiar with the equipment? Could they trouble-shoot machine problems, or even step in to keep things running if necessary? Do they know how to get technical assistance when needed?
  2. Do they see and understand the bigger picture? As a supervisor, they must understand the goals of the organization, what, precisely, their own role is in the scheme of things, and what they should expect from the people they supervise.
  3. Can they lead? A manager may maintain the status quo, but leaders constantly look for opportunities to improve their processes, and can inspire the people who report to them to do the same.
  4. Do they communicate well? Communication is not simply telling people what to do. It’s also listening to what they have to say. The supervisor must be able to have meaningful conversations with their reports to insure that everyone is on the same page, that any concerns are followed up and that there are no misunderstandings.
  5. Can they learn and educate others? Are they capable of learning new technologies, systems and techniques and then passing on the knowledge to those who report to them?

Having the right people in the right jobs is critical to the success of a CNC shop.
